CVE-2022-2351
The Post SMTP Mailer/Email Log plugin contains a stored cross-site scripting vulnerability in versions through 2.1.3 affecting the 'input_tmp_dir' parameter. Administrators can inject malicious scripts due to inadequate sanitization and escaping of user input. These injected scripts execute in the browsers of users who view affected pages. The vulnerability requires authenticated access with administrator privileges to exploit.
